drm/i915/runtime_pm: Prefer drm_WARN* over WARN*



struct drm_device specific drm_WARN* macros include device information
in the backtrace, so we know what device the warnings originate from.

Prefer drm_WARN* over WARN*.

Conversion is done with below semantic patch:

@@
identifier func, T;
@@
func(struct intel_runtime_pm *T,...) {
+ struct drm_i915_private *i915 = container_of(T, struct drm_i915_private, runtime_pm);
<+...
(
-WARN(
+drm_WARN(&i915->drm,
...)
|
-WARN_ON(
+drm_WARN_ON(&i915->drm,
...)
|
-WARN_ONCE(
+drm_WARN_ONCE(&i915->drm,
...)
|
-WARN_ON_ONCE(
+drm_WARN_ON_ONCE(&i915->drm,
...)
)
...+>

}
